What is a healthy church?
"[A] congregation that increasingly reflects God's character as his character has been revealed in his Word."
- Mark Dever,
What is a Healthy Church?

The Church Health Team is convinced that to become Great Commission congregations we must become captivated by the greatness of our majestic God. It is as we behold Jesus the King that we are "transformed into his likeness with ever-increasing glory" (2 Corinthians 3:18). To that end, we strive to provide resources, training and support to help make "the gospel of the grace of God" (Acts 20:24) central in all our churches.

Church Health Institutes
The Church Health Institute provides the tools for digging and the means to build the capacity for health and fruitfulness. Through the simple principles of the High Impact Ministry framework and the work of the Holy Spirit, your congregation can become effective and efficient in reaching your community for Christ. 

Through the framework of the “Well-Lived Minister’s Life,” you will discover that every single aspect of your life is integrated in order to live an abundant life. As the spiritual leader, it is of the utmost importance that you model to all: spiritual vitality, sustaining leadership competence, marriage and family, balance and more.
